Hello, I have somehow managed to get spyware on my computer. I have Norton antivirus software installed so im not sure exactly how this happened. The person I got the computer from had the firewall turned off?? Could that have caused it? Also one more question, it is causing my computer to run really slow and I keep getting alot of pop-ups, how do I get this off of my computer?? Thanks for your help.

Answer
Hi Michelle,

Yes, if the firewall is not on, anything could access computer. Zone Alarm, is a free firewall program that many people prefer over the one that comes with Windows XP, check it out at:

http://www.pcworld.com/downloads/file/fid,7228-page,1-c,downloads/description.ht...

I would suggest downloading Spybot - Search & Destroy 1.5, a program that removes spyware, available from:

http://www.download.com/Spybot-Search-Destroy/3000-8022_4-10743107.html?tag=lst-...

Check for updates before running. If you have trouble getting the updates, near the top of the Update Window, click the little arrow next See-Cure  #1(Europe), highlight the next one on the list, See-Cure #2 and try to download the updates. If that doesn't work, try the next one the list. until you get one you can download from. Being a free program, if too many people are using the same site to download the updates, some people will not get them.

Regarding NAV, make sure that it updated and you run a scan once a week.
